Palladium complex compounds as catalysts for cross-coupling reactions for the preparation of functional materials.

Part 2. Suzuki–Miyaura and Mizoroki–Heck reactions
Kirillova V.A., Leonov A.A., Platonova Ya.B., Savilov S.V.
Abstract

The review considers catalytic systems based on a variety of palladium complexes for Suzuki–Miyaura and Mizoroki–Heck reactions in homogeneous and heterogeneous versions. It has been shown that the use of organosilenium and carbene ligands makes it possible to achieve quantitative yields at ultra-low catalyst loads. Approaches to the immobilization of complexes onto different carriers that enable repeated use of catalysts and minimal metal loss are considered. The practical significance of the considered reactions for the creation of functional materials with specified characteristics is noted.
